Transaction 561a01d331f43ab7e45792cddeef66ce8d8416ed20f68035c1c90baca326c3e5

3 Input
2 Outputs
  • 561a01d331f43ab7e45792cddeef66ce8d8416ed20f68035c1c90baca326c3e5:0
  • value  575993
    address  12SpudCrziW89wmpH8E26FS8V51B3x389x
  • 561a01d331f43ab7e45792cddeef66ce8d8416ed20f68035c1c90baca326c3e5:1
  • value  4562882
    address  36zDXCyhwo5b16qceqkvwhn8PNZH2k4QpX